项目摘要

The proposed ARW is to provide a forum for free-spirited exchange and debate of views,visions, and ideas. The format includes both prepared invited presentations and ad hoccontributions with uninhibited exchange of views and rebuttals. Some of the key luminarieswill come to share their opinions and to lead the discussions on where the technologies are going and/or should be going. Balanced representations of advocacy and oppositionwill be intentionally sought.Each day will start with presentations given by key speakers on subjects in one or twochosen themes. It is then followed by debates and invited talks by other participants.All oral presentations (in morning sessions) are to focus on the presenter's views andprojections of future directions, assessments or critiques of important newideas/approaches, and NOT on their own achievements. The presenters are asked to beprovocative and/or inspiring.Latest advances made and results obtained by the participants will be presented in theafternoon sessions in the form of posters and group/individual discussions.The day will be concluded by an evening panels session that attempts to further thedebates on selected controversial issues connected to the theme of the day. Each sessionwill be chaired by one forceful character that will invite 2-3 attendees of his/her choiceto lead with a position statement, all other attendees being the panelists. The debatewill be forcefully moderated and irrelevant digressions will be cut off without mercy.Moderators will be also assigned a hopeless task to forge a consensus on critical issues.For these considerations, a format has been choosen that is less rigid than normal workshops toallow and encourage uninhibited exchanges and sometimes confrontation of different views.A design a central theme will be designed together with the speakers for each day.
